Subject: Handover — validator plugin stuff

Hey Priya,

Passing you the baton on Checkwright, our plugin system for data validators. The new schema-drift plugin shipped Tuesday and mostly behaves, but it occasionally flags empty CSV uploads as "malformed" — harmless, just noisy. I've muted the alert until Friday. If support escalates anything about plugin load failures, the fix is usually bumping the registry cache. Questions after I'm off? Reach the Checkwright maintainers at the address below.

billing contact of hawip-kahif = zorwyn@tolvaqlabs.corp

# Artifact Signing — Report Export Service (Timezone Handling)

All builds of the Clockline export service must be signed before promotion. This matters especially for timezone-handling patches: unsigned builds bypass the regression suite that checks UTC-offset conversion in scheduled reports, which is how the Veldstad incident happened. New team members should sign only from the designated release workstation, never from a laptop. After the export artifact passes the offset-conversion tests, sign it with the release key below.

rollout seal: bky4_DFM9

// MAX_FANOUT_QUEUE_DEPTH controls backpressure for the Pellwick notifier.
// When the fan-out queue exceeds this depth, producers are throttled and
// low-priority digests are shed first. Raising it trades memory for latency;
// lowering it causes earlier shedding but protects the Kestrel broker from
// cascading timeouts. If you're on call and seeing sustained shedding,
// check consumer lag before touching this value — the constant is rarely
// the real problem. The depth used in the last verified soak run is
// recorded below.

pipeline stamp: htk9_6ce9d33c5